This guy is very incompetent and HUD's guidelines allows anyone to be a consultant. He cant bid job himself so he relies upon contractors bid estimate to come up with writeup numbers. He is supposed to give you guidelines to compare the contractors number so that they dont rip you off. So he basically uses their numbers and doesnt even add the numbers up correctly. We went back and forth trying to get him to make the numbers match the contractors numbers that I had chosen. Why would he not add the numbers exactly as they entered them when he waited several weeks to get the details of the repairs from the contractor.

I paid for blueprints and everything to make this job run smoothly. In the end, I had to request an extension 3Xs because he could not implement the information the contractor gave me. I suspected he was either incompetent or fraudulent. My initial thought was fraudulent when he asked me how much I was paying for the property. I had gotten it from the bank for $35000 which was a steal. Something told me that he was either jealous or had an interest in the property.

I contacted HUD when he was still unable to produce a writeup and necessary documents within 4 months from his initial visit out to the property. I even tried to get another contractor to work with him. It was no use. HUD got him to turn in one document and it turned out to be incorrect and the contractor refuse to sign it because that would make them liable to complete the work for less money and not get reimbursed properly for work.

In the end, he was the cause for my losing the property. The seller refuses to extend the contract any further. I suspect thatVito will have some hand in picking the property up after my loss. Go figure!

I found out that other consultants have a guarantee of 36-48 hr turn around for the writeup. All of their prices were lower than his as well. According to HUD the max it should cost you for repairs that are >$100k is $900. He charged mea total of $2000 including the feasibility fee. Apparently, the most they should request in a downpayment is $400 before closing.

HUD told me there isnt much they can do after I paid him in full except make a complaint. I intend to sue him in court.

FYI, I later found out that he has all types of fraudulent suits against him. Be sure to Google any consultant. Just because they are HUD approved means nothing. This guy is just plain old Fraudulent!
